Great newsPayPal Payments Re-enabled at Sav
As of 10:30 AM CDT on August 22, PayPal has re-enabled our ability to accept payments via PayPal. We learned this morning that our account was disabled last week due only to a domain name that had no association with Sav. We provided this explanation to PayPal and they promptly re-enabled our access. Most importantly, we just wanted to give our huge thanks to the domain community and our many users for taking the time to reach out to PayPal on social media to promptly bring this matter to their attention!
